What is the function of a flocculant in water treatment?

The function of a flocculant in water treatment is to aggregate suspended particles into larger clumps, also known as flocs. This process is essential for enhancing the removal of particulates and contaminants from the water. Flocculants are chemicals that, when added to water, promote the binding of small particles into larger aggregates. These aggregates can then be easily removed from the water during subsequent treatment stages, such as sedimentation or filtration.

This aggregation improves the overall efficiency of the water treatment process, as it allows for a more effective removal of impurities that could otherwise remain suspended and contribute to poor water quality. By forming larger clumps, the particles become heavier and settle more quickly, facilitating their removal and thereby enhancing the clarity and quality of the water.
